Assistant Warehouse Manager
About this job
Essential Function
1. Workshop Operations Management
Manage and oversee daily workshop operations, including job allocation, manpower planning, and scheduling.
Monitor workflow to ensure timely completion of repairs and servicing tasks.
Ensure all work is carried out in accordance with company standards and manufacturer specifications.
2. Safety & Compliance
Maintain a safe work environment and ensure strict adherence to safety policies and procedures.
Ensure compliance with all company safety rules and regulatory requirements at all times to prevent accidents or incidents.
3. Technical Support & Troubleshooting
Provide technical guidance and support to workshop personnel.
Recommend and implement appropriate corrective measures for mechanical or operational issues.
4. Documentation & Reporting
Ensure proper documentation of all repair and servicing work, including detailed records of parts used and labor performed.
Maintain accurate workshop records for audit and compliance purposes.
5. Team Leadership & Supervision
Supervise, train, and mentor workshop staff to improve skills and performance.
Conduct performance evaluations and recommend training programs where necessary.
Foster teamwork, discipline, and a positive working environment.
6. Inventory Management
Monitor inventory levels of spare parts, tools, and consumables.
Coordinate with procurement to ensure availability of necessary materials.
Ensure proper maintenance and calibration of tools and workshop equipment.
7. Cost Control
Monitor workshop expenses and control operational costs.
Ensure efficient utilization of manpower and resources
Qualifications
Diploma graduates from Electrical or Mechanical Engineering with minimum 2 years experiences in handling diesel engine repair and maintenance at site or those who has experience working in similar rental industries is desirable.
Meticulous person with a good communications skill for dealing with people from diverse background.
Persistent individual who are a perfectionist at times and an efficient person at all times.
Possess Singapore Class 3 driving license
